These tutorials cover a range of topics on hadoop and the ecosystem projects. It helps us to know the performance comparison between hbase and mongodb over. The purpose of using a nosql database is for distributed data stores with humongous data storage needs. Hadoop installation for beginners and professionals with examples on hive, java installation, ssh installation, hadoop installation, pig, hbase, hdfs, mapreduce. Hadoop developer course contents hadoop online tutorials. The apache kafka project management committee has packed a number of valuable enhancements into the release. Cdh is based entirely on open standards for longterm architecture.
Yes, i consent to my information being shared with clouderas solution partners to offer related products and services. As the torrent of water dried up for the first time in thousands of years, it revealed a horrific sight. Hadoop tutorial social media data generation stats. Hbase can store massive amounts of data from terabytes to petabytes. Supported in the context of apache hbase, supported means that hbase is designed to work in the way described, and deviation from the defined behavior or functionality should be reported as a bug.
I wrote a scirpt to fetch fb notifications and show them on my screen. The tutorials for the mapr sandbox get you started with converged data application development in minutes. Nosql is a nonrelational dbms, that does not require a fixed schema, avoids joins, and is easy to scale. Tutorialspoint pdf collections 619 tutorial files mediafire 8, 2017 8, 2017 un4ckn0wl3z tutorialspoint pdf collections 619 tutorial files by un4ckn0wl3z haxtivitiez. Hbase is an opensource, columnoriented distributed database system in a hadoop environment. This tutorial demonstrates how to perform a batch file load, using apache druids native batch ingestion. These are the html tutorial for beginners pdf files, by which while sitting at home you can start learning. This big data hadoop tutorial will cover the preinstallation environment setup to install hadoop on ubuntu and detail out the steps for hadoop single node setup so that you perform basic data analysis operations on hdfs and hadoop mapreduce. It process structured and semistructured data in hadoop.
Sqoop command submitted by the end user is parsed by sqoop and launches hadoop map only job to import or export data because reduce phase. You can use the supplied tutorial code and data to experiment with pig and hbase. Hbase tutorial provides basic and advanced concepts of hbase. The apache hadoop is an opensource project which allows for the distributed processing of huge data sets across clusters of computers using simple programming models. This tutorial will give you great understanding on mongodb concepts needed to create and deploy a highly scalable and performance oriented database. Hbase security we can grant and revoke permissions to users in hbase. Course duration details complete course training will be done in 4550 hours total duration of course will be around 6 weeks planning 8 hoursweek. Even if an entire rack were to fail for example, both tor switches in a single rack, the cluster would still function, albeit at a lower level of performance. This tutorial provides an introduction to hbase, the procedures to set up hbase on hadoop file systems, and ways to interact with hbase shell. Tutorials point had started video tutorials courses in the year 2016. Hbase is used whenever we need to provide fast random access to available data. A mediumsize cluster has multiple racks, where the three master nodes are distributed across the racks. Anyone can watch tutorials point videos on youtube channel to improve his knowledge on.
At phptpoint we provide html tutorial pdf so that you can download the files conveniently and make your learning technique more easier. Hbase architecture watch more videos at videotutorialsindex. What are some good examples and tutorials for learning hbase. Big data refers to the datasets too large and complex for traditional systems to store and process. If you want a good grasp on apache hadoop, these tutorials are perfect for you. Your contribution will go a long way in helping us. Which is the best site for learning hadoop online tutorial for beginners. In this blog post, ill discuss how hbase schema is different from traditional relational schema modeling, and ill also provide you with some guidelines for proper hbase schema design.
Hbase is a nonrelational, opensource, columnoriented database. As we mentioned in our hadoop ecosytem blog, hbase is an essential part of our hadoop ecosystem. Demo videos demo 1 big data hadoop introduction demo 2 hadoop vm startup. The apache hbase team assumes no responsibility for your hbase clusters, your configuration, or your data.
Introduction to hbase watch more videos at lecture by. What will you learn from this hadoop tutorial for beginners. Our hbase tutorial is designed for beginners and professionals. Hadoop tutorial getting started with big data and hadoop. Hadoop tutorial for big data enthusiasts dataflair.
The apache hadoop software library is a framework that allows for the distributed processing of large data sets across clusters of computers using simple programming models. The mapr smart home tutorial is designated to walk the developer through a process of developing event processing. I hbase is not a columnoriented db in the typical term i hbase uses an ondisk column storage format i. You can use sqoop to import data from a relational database management system rdbms such as mysql or oracle or a mainframe into the hadoop distributed file system hdfs, transform the data in hadoop mapreduce, and then export the data back into an rdbms. For this tutorial, well assume youve already downloaded druid as described in the quickstart using the microquickstart singlemachine configuration and have it running on your local machine. Course duration details complete course training will be done in 6065 hours total duration of course will be around 5 weeks planning 10 hoursweek. This tutorial provides an introduction to hbase, the procedures to set. Alternatively, you can download a static snapshot of the entire archive using the github. Html tutorials pdf are the files which have free downloading process and easy access for your learning. Companies such as facebook, twitter, yahoo, and adobe use hbase internally. Take out any practical scenrio and try to implement it in python. Objectrelational mapping orm with hbase data entities. Apache hadoop tutorial v about the author martin is a software engineer with more than 10 years of experience in software development.
Demo videos demo 1 big data hadoop introduction demo 2 hadoop vm startup demo. So now, i would like to take you through hbase tutorial, where i will introduce you to apache hbase, and then, we will go through the facebook messenger casestudy. Hbase is an open source framework provided by apache. With the help of tutorial point videos, the concepts on various topics is clearly given in a simple and easy language. From monday to thursday 2 hoursday total 8 hours4 days friday, saturday and sundays will be left for practicing. Hbase theory and practice of a distributed data store pietro michiardi eurecom pietro michiardi eurecom tutorial. In this class, you will learn how to install, use and store data. Apache hbase is needed for realtime big data applications. Follow this tutorial to integrate connectivity to hbase data into a javabased orm framework, hibernate. This projects goal is the hosting of very large tables billions of rows x millions of columns atop clusters of commodity hardware. I hbase is not a columnoriented db in the typical term i hbase uses an ondisk column storage format i provides keybased access to speci. Hive is a data warehouse infrastructure tool to process structured data in hadoop. Class summary hbase is a leading nosql database in the hadoop ecosystem.
You can update an existing cell value using the put command. Developing bigdata applications with apache hadoop interested in live training from the author of these tutorials. There is no onetoone mapping from relational databases to hbase. And as the main curator of open standards in hadoop, cloudera has a track record of bringing new open source solutions into its platform such as apache spark, apache hbase, and apache parquet that. While hbase is highly scalable and performant for a subset of use cases, mongodb can be used across a broader range of applications. Applications of hbase it is used whenever there is a need to write heavy applications. Find, read and cite all the research you need on researchgate. As a result, you must include backticks around the hive if conditional function when you use it in a query on hive tables. Apache hive is an open source data warehouse system built on top of hadoop haused for querying and analyzing large datasets stored in hadoop files. In this article, we list down 10 free online resources where you can get a clear vision about hadoop and its ecosystem. Point hbase at the running hadoop hdfs instance by setting. Sqoop architecture sqoop provides command line interface to the end users.
Apart from the rate at which the data is getting generated, the second factor is the lack of proper format or structure in these data sets that makes processing a challenge. Apache hive in depth hive tutorial for beginners dataflair. Now, lets begin our interesting hadoop tutorial with the basic introduction to big data.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. It resides on top of hadoop to summarize big data, and makes querying and analyzing easy. The definitive guide to free hadoop tutorial for beginners.
Once youre comfortable with your skills and ready to find out what hadoop can do for you, any of the following free hadoop tutorials is a great place to start. See the upcoming hadoop training course in maryland, cosponsored by johns hopkins engineering for professionals. Mongodbs design philosophy blends key concepts from relational technologies with the benefits of emerging nosql databases. Objectrelational mapping orm techniques make it easier to work with relational data sources and can bridge your logical business model with your physical storage model. Sqoop is a tool designed to transfer data between hadoop and relational databases or mainframes. Welcome to apache hbase apache hbase is the hadoop database, a distributed, scalable, big data store use apache hbase when you need random, realtime readwrite access to your big data. Feb 2007 initial hbase prototype was created as a hadoop contribution. Tutorials point simply easy learning page 1 about the tutorial mongodb tutorial mongodb is an opensource document database, and leading nosql database. All the content and graphics published in this ebook are the property of tutorials point i.
136 1150 6 811 700 662 1439 59 258 604 256 340 1394 1297 1329 1003 243 946 655 617 335 264 588 1321 1360 703 1328 867 938 435